Item 1.01                      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ement

On July 16, 2015, Sunshine Bank (the “Bank”), the wholly-owned banking subsidiary of Sunshine Bancorp, Inc. (the “Company”), entered into a Purchase and Assumption Agreement with First Federal Bank of Florida (“First Federal”), pursuant to which the Bank agreed to acquire three First Federal branch offices, but only the office locations at 8307 Lockwood Ridge Rd., Sarasota, Florida and 6004 26th Street West, Bradenton, Florida. First Federal intends to close and consolidate the branch located at 126 South Osprey Ave., Sarasota, Florida into the other two branches prior to the completion of the transaction. The purchase includes the assumption of approximately $56.4 million of deposits for a deposit premium of 1.80% and approximately $8.3 million of loans at par value. The Bank has also agreed to purchase some selected fixed assets associated with the branches and intends to retain the branch employees.  Subject to regulatory approval and customary closing conditions, the transaction is expected to close in October 2015.
